Six-year-old Isabelle is good at looking after her dad, cat Steve, friend Harry B, and baby cousin Bibi. She meets a new girl at school with the same name, Isobel, and they become friends. Jane Godwin's stories are about Isabelle's world, trials, triumphs, and growing up, with illustrations by Robin Cowcher.

Six-year-old Isabelle lives in a small town with her father, cat named Steve, her best friend Harry B, and her baby cousin, Bibi. She loves spending time with them and takes great care of Bibi. However, her life changes when a new girl named Isobel joins her school. They have the same name, but will they become friends?
The first story, "Isabelle and the Missing Toy," tells the tale of Isabelle's search for her favorite toy, which has gone missing. She and Harry B team up to find it, and in the process, they learn the importance of friendship and teamwork.
In "Isabelle and the New Girl," Isabelle is hesitant to befriend Isobel at first, but eventually, they become friends. They learn to appreciate their differences and support each other through thick and thin.
"Isabelle and the School Play" is a story about Isabelle's involvement in a school play. She is nervous at first, but with the help of her friends and family, she overcomes her fears and shines on stage.
"Isabelle and the Family Trip" takes Isabelle and her family on a vacation to the beach. They have a lot of fun together, but also face challenges that test their relationships. Through it all, Isabelle learns the value of family and the importance of being there for each other.
The final story, "Isabelle and the Secret Friend," is about a mysterious girl who Isabelle meets at the park. They become friends, but Isabelle soon realizes that the girl has a secret that could change their lives forever.
Through these stories, Jane Godwin explores the joys and challenges of childhood, friendship, family, and growing up. She writes with empathy and understanding, capturing the essence of what it means to be a child or young person. The illustrations by Robin Cowcher are beautiful and add to the charm of the stories.
